require_once 'lib/DoctrineTestInit.php';
/**
 * Test case for testing the saving and referencing of query identifiers.
 *
 * @package     Doctrine
 * @subpackage  Query
 * @author      Guilherme Blanco <guilhermeblanco@hotmail.com>
 * @author      Janne Vanhala <jpvanhal@cc.hut.fi>
 * @author      Konsta Vesterinen <kvesteri@cc.hut.fi>
 * @license     http://www.opensource.org/licenses/lgpl-license.php LGPL
 * @link        http://www.phpdoctrine.org
 * @since       2.0
 * @version     $Revision$
 * @todo        1) [romanb] We  might want to split the SQL generation tests into multiple
 *              testcases later since we'll have a lot of them and we might want to have special SQL
 *              generation tests for some dbms specific SQL syntaxes.
 */
class Orm_Query_DeleteSqlGenerationTest extends Doctrine_OrmTestCase
{
    public function assertSqlGeneration($dqlToBeTested, $sqlToBeConfirmed)
    {
        try {
            $entityManager = $this->_em;
            $query = $entityManager->createQuery($dqlToBeTested);

            parent::assertEquals($sqlToBeConfirmed, $query->getSql());

            $query->free();
        } catch (Doctrine_Exception $e) {
            $this->fail($e->getMessage());
        }
    }


    public function testWithoutWhere()
    {
        // NO WhereClause
        $this->assertSqlGeneration(
            'DELETE CmsUser u', 
            'DELETE FROM cms_user cu WHERE 1 = 1'
        );

        $this->assertSqlGeneration(
            'DELETE FROM CmsUser u',
            'DELETE FROM cms_user cu WHERE 1 = 1'
        );
    }


    public function testWithWhere()
    {
        // "WHERE" ConditionalExpression
        // ConditionalExpression = ConditionalTerm {"OR" ConditionalTerm}
        // ConditionalTerm       = ConditionalFactor {"AND" ConditionalFactor}
        // ConditionalFactor     = ["NOT"] ConditionalPrimary
        // ConditionalPrimary    = SimpleConditionalExpression | "(" ConditionalExpression ")"
        // SimpleConditionalExpression
        //                       = Expression (ComparisonExpression | BetweenExpression | LikeExpression
        //                       | InExpression | NullComparisonExpression) | ExistsExpression

        // If this one test fail, all others will fail too. That's the simplest case possible
        $this->assertSqlGeneration(
            'DELETE CmsUser u WHERE id = ?',
            'DELETE FROM cms_user cu WHERE cu.id = ?'
        );
    }


    public function testWithConditionalExpressions()
    {
        $this->assertSqlGeneration(
            'DELETE CmsUser u WHERE u.username = ? OR u.name = ?',
            'DELETE FROM cms_user cu WHERE cu.username = ? OR cu.name = ?'
        );

        $this->assertSqlGeneration(
            'DELETE CmsUser u WHERE u.id = ? OR ( u.username = ? OR u.name = ? )',
            'DELETE FROM cms_user cu WHERE cu.id = ? OR (cu.username = ? OR cu.name = ?)'
        );

        $this->assertSqlGeneration(
            'DELETE FROM CmsUser WHERE id = ?',
            'DELETE FROM cms_user cu WHERE cu.id = ?'
        );
    }


    public function testParserIsCaseAgnostic()
    {
        $this->assertSqlGeneration(
            "delete from CmsUser u where u.username = ?",
            "DELETE FROM cms_user cu WHERE cu.username = ?"
        );
    }


    public function testWithConditionalTerms()
    {
        $this->assertSqlGeneration(
            "DELETE CmsUser u WHERE u.username = ? AND u.name = ?",
            "DELETE FROM cms_user cu WHERE cu.username = ? AND cu.name = ?"
        );
    }


    public function testWithConditionalFactors()
    {
        $this->assertSqlGeneration(
            "DELETE CmsUser u WHERE NOT id != ?",
            "DELETE FROM cms_user cu WHERE NOT cu.id <> ?"
        );

        $this->assertSqlGeneration(
            "DELETE CmsUser u WHERE NOT ( id != ? )",
            "DELETE FROM cms_user cu WHERE NOT (cu.id <> ?)"
        );

        $this->assertSqlGeneration(
            "DELETE CmsUser u WHERE NOT ( id != ? AND username = ? )",
            "DELETE FROM cms_user cu WHERE NOT (cu.id <> ? AND cu.username = ?)"
        );
    }
